About PWB Capital LLC
PWB Capital is an operator-led investment firm focused on acquiring and growing lower middle market businesses in Mission-Critical Government and Defense Services. We partner with founders and management teams at key transition points, bringing hands-on operational experience, disciplined execution, and a long-term approach to value creation. Our focus is centered on businesses operating in Mission-Critical Government and Defense Services where operational expertise, trusted relationships, and execution matters. Prior to launching PWB Capital, our leadership team founded, scaled, and successfully exited a nationally recognized government services company supporting customers across the defense and national security landscape. At PWB Capital, we understand the responsibility that comes with building a business. We seek to preserve the culture, relationships, and reputation founders have spent years creating while providing the strategic support and operational leadership needed for long-term growth. PWB Capital is actively seeking acquisition opportunities across the lower middle market.

Legal & Regulatory
PWB Capital LLC notes that the CAS Board published two final rules on September 1, with basic applicability moving from $2.5 million to $35 million and full coverage and Disclosure Statement filing moving from $50 million to $100 million.

Legal & Regulatory
PWB Capital LLC notes that the FAR Council has proposed cutting the deadline to submit a termination settlement proposal from one year to 90 days under FAR Case 2026-007.
